Oven, Stovetop, Frying pan, Baking dish
Step 1
Preheat the oven to 400°F. Wash & dice the peppers.
Step 2
Peel & dice the onions.
Step 3
Heat a drizzle of olive oil in a pan over medium heat. Add the onions & peppers. Cook, stirring for 3 min.
Step 4
Add the ground beef & half of the canned tomatoes. Season with salt & pepper. Stir & cook for 3-5 min, or until the beef is cooked through. Remove the pan from the heat.
Step 5
Lay a tortilla on your work surface. Fill it with a dollop of sour cream & a spoonful of the beef-tomato mixture. Roll up the tortilla & place it into a baking dish. Continue with the remaining filling & tortillas. Be sure to arrange them snugly in the dish!
Step 6
Spread the remaining tomato sauce over top. Sprinkle with grated cheese. Season with salt & pepper. Bake for 15-20 min or until heated through & melty on top. Enjoy!
Average estimated amount for one serving
Energy | 986 cal. |
Fat | 59 g |
Carbohydrates | 52 g |
Protein | 60 g |
Fiber | 6 g |
